The Basics of Shipping Containers
Shipping containers were established in the mid-20th century to improve worldwide shipping. Available in standard sizes-- most commonly 20-foot and 40-foot-- they have ended up being the backbone of international trade.
Table 1: Common Shipping Container DimensionsContainer TypeLength (feet)Width (ft)Height (feet)Typical Volume (cu ft)Standard2088.51,169High Cube4089.52,694Basic4088.52,390High Cube2089.51,350
These dimensions make them perfect for different usages aside from conventional shipping.
Diverse Applications of Shipping Containers1. Housing and Modular Construction
One of the most exciting advancements in shipping container use is their adaptation for housing. Compact, durable, and reasonably inexpensive, they use distinct solutions to the housing crisis.
Cost: Compared to traditional building methods, building homes with shipping containers can reduce costs by 20-30%.Sustainability: By recycling old containers, contractors can produce low-impact homes that minimize waste.Speed of Construction: Container homes can be constructed quickly, typically within weeks, thanks to their modular nature.List of Container Home FeaturesEnergy efficiency (photovoltaic panels, efficient insulation)Customizability (layout, designs)Mobility (easily carried)Resilience (long lasting under extreme weather condition)2. Retail and Pop-Up Shops
Shipping containers are becoming progressively popular as retail areas. They can be changed into pop-up shops, food stalls, and even irreversible stores. This trend is particularly noted in urban areas where area is valuable.
Flexibility: They can be put practically anywhere, targeting high-traffic locations.Branding: Unique container designs can improve a brand's image, attracting clients.Cost-effectiveness: Lower overhead costs make it simpler for small services to get in the market.Table 2: Advantages of Shipping Containers in RetailBenefitExplanationLower rental expensesLess expensive than traditional retail areasBrief setup timeQuick installation permits rapid entryCustomization optionsEasy to customize for branding needsEco-friendly optionUses recycled products3. Art Installations and Creative Spaces
Artists have actually begun utilizing shipping containers as canvases and galleries. Their distinct shapes and sizes inspire ingenious installations, making them a trendy option in public and personal art tasks.
List of Artistic ApplicationsInteractive art installationsGallery spaces for exhibitionsEfficiency placesMobile art studiosShipping Containers: A Sustainable Choice

Table 3: Environmental Benefits of Using Shipping ContainersAdvantageDescriptionMinimized WasteRecycling old containers decreases landfill useLower Energy ConsumptionMany designs concentrate on eco-friendly practicesVery Little Resource UseNeeds less new materials compared to standard buildsFAQs about Shipping ContainersQ1: Can shipping containers be used for long-term housing?
A1: Yes, lots of housing tasks utilize shipping containers as long-term homes, specifically in regions dealing with housing shortages.
Q2: How do shipping containers hold up against extreme weather condition?
A2: Shipping containers are designed to stand up to extreme marine conditions, making them durable versus severe weather condition occasions.
Q3: Are shipping containers safe to utilize?
A3: Yes, effectively modified shipping containers fulfill developing codes and security standards. It's important to speak with professionals throughout the modification process.
Q4: What are the expenses related to buying and modifying a shipping container?
A4: The cost can differ widely depending upon size, condition, and modifications however generally ranges from 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 5,000 for the container itself, with extra costs for modification that can go beyond the initial purchase rate.
Q5: Where can I buy shipping containers?
A5: Shipping containers can be bought from specialized dealers, shipping business, or online markets.
